Hi there, I'm Laura!

I'm glad you're here! I believe that self-awareness and self-compassion are two tools that can help everyone lead a life with purpose, clarity, and joy. Therapy can provide the means, the scaffolding, and accountability to move toward the life you decide!

My focus

I love working with clients who are in transition. Maybe you are moving, changing jobs, or transitioning into marriage or parenthood. Even positive and exciting changes are a time to stop and reflect. AND not all transitions are desired changes; I can work to support you in processing the grief and loss you face as well.

My approach

My therapy approach is client-centered, meaning your personality and preferences influence the way I show up for you. Therapy is NOT one size fits all. Each client-therapist relationship is unique and evolves over sessions. There is no magical, secret therapy tool, but there are simple things that can make a difference.
